A 4IN. RADIUS VERNIER SEXTANT BY CARY, LONDON, CIRCA 1893
the oxidised brass T-frame with polished arc signed and inscribed Cary London 1089, with inset silver scale divided to 150°, vernier with swivel magnifier, mirrors, six shades, pin feet and wooden handle with stand escutcheon, contained within fitted wooden box with accessories including three sighting tubes and the lid inset with test certificate dated 1893 – 7in. (18cm.) diam
